public long getDuration() { return getMovieHeader().getDuration(); }
public int getTimescale() { return getMovieHeader().getTimescale(); }
public long getDuration() { return getMovieHeader().getDuration(); }
public int getTimescale() { return getMovieHeader().getTimescale(); }
public long getDuration() { return getMovieHeader().getDuration(); }
public int getTimescale() { return getMovieHeader().getTimescale(); }
public void setDuration(long movDuration) { getMovieHeader().setDuration(movDuration); }
public void setDuration(long movDuration) { getMovieHeader().setDuration(movDuration); }
public void setDuration(long movDuration) { getMovieHeader().setDuration(movDuration); }
public void appendTrack(TrakBox newTrack) { newTrack.getTrackHeader().setNo(getMovieHeader().getNextTrackId()); getMovieHeader().setNextTrackId(getMovieHeader().getNextTrackId() + 1); boxes.add(newTrack); }
public void appendTrack(TrakBox newTrack) { newTrack.getTrackHeader().setNo(getMovieHeader().getNextTrackId()); getMovieHeader().setNextTrackId(getMovieHeader().getNextTrackId() + 1); boxes.add(newTrack); }
public void appendTrack(TrakBox newTrack) { newTrack.getTrackHeader().setNo(getMovieHeader().getNextTrackId()); getMovieHeader().setNextTrackId(getMovieHeader().getNextTrackId() + 1); boxes.add(newTrack); }
public void updateDuration() { TrakBox[] tracks = getTracks(); long min = Integer.MAX_VALUE; for (int i = 0; i < tracks.length; i++) { TrakBox trakBox = tracks[i]; if (trakBox.getDuration() < min) min = trakBox.getDuration(); } getMovieHeader().setDuration(min); }
public void updateDuration() { TrakBox[] tracks = getTracks(); long min = Integer.MAX_VALUE; for (TrakBox trakBox : tracks) { if (trakBox.getDuration() < min) min = trakBox.getDuration(); } getMovieHeader().setDuration(min); }
public void updateDuration() { TrakBox[] tracks = getTracks(); long min = Integer.MAX_VALUE; for (TrakBox trakBox : tracks) { if (trakBox.getDuration() < min) min = trakBox.getDuration(); } getMovieHeader().setDuration(min); }